Book Price $0 : Kathryn Canas and Harris Sondak's second edition of 'Opportunities and Challenges of Workplace Diversity: Theory, Cases, and Exercises' is a comprehensive exploration into the dynamics of diversity in modern work environments. This book delves into how diversity enriches the workplace, offering a crucial examination of strategies and practices that promote inclusion. Key themes include racial and ethnic diversity, gender differences, age diversity, and the inclusion of individuals with disabilities. Through a series of robust case studies and hands-on exercises, the book encourages learners to engage directly with real-world challenges, fostering an environment for practical application of theoretical concepts.
